在移动开发的世界里,Swift 语言以其安全、高效和现代的特性成为了苹果平台的首选。康康金棕教程,作为入门Swift编程的优质资源,能够帮助你快速掌握移动开发的技巧。本文将为你详细解析康康金棕教程中的关键内容,助你轻松入门Swift编程。
Swift编程简介
Swift 是由苹果公司开发的一种编程语言,用于构建 iOS、macOS、watchOS 和 tvOS 应用。它旨在提供一种更安全、更直观、更强大的编程语言,以适应现代移动开发的需求。
Swift语言的特点
- 安全性高:Swift语言的设计注重安全,减少了常见的安全问题,如空指针引用和数组越界。
- 高性能:Swift在性能上与C++相近,同时提供了丰富的现代编程特性。
- 易学易用:Swift语法简洁,易于学习和使用。
康康金棕教程详解
康康金棕教程是一套针对Swift编程初学者的教程,以下将详细解析教程中的几个关键部分。
1. Swift基础语法
- 变量和常量:在Swift中,使用
var关键字声明变量,使用let关键字声明常量。var name = "康康" let age = 30 - 数据类型:Swift提供了多种数据类型,如整型(Int)、浮点型(Double)、字符串(String)等。
- 控制流:Swift使用
if、switch等关键字进行条件判断和循环操作。if age > 18 { print("成年了!") } else { print("未成年!") }
2. 函数与闭包
- 函数:Swift中的函数使用
func关键字声明。func greet(person: String) -> String { return "Hello, " + person } - 闭包:闭包是一种可以捕获并记住其周围状态的功能代码块。
let closure = { (x: Int, y: Int) -> Int in return x + y } let result = closure(2, 3)
3. 类与结构体
- 类:Swift中的类用于定义对象,包含属性和方法。
class Person { var name: String init(name: String) { self.name = name } } - 结构体:Swift中的结构体与类类似,但更轻量级,适用于值类型。
struct Point { var x: Int var y: Int }
4. Swift UI
Swift UI是苹果公司推出的全新界面构建框架,用于构建用户界面。康康金棕教程中会介绍如何使用Swift UI构建界面。
5. 实战项目
康康金棕教程会带你完成一些实战项目,如制作一个简单的计算器、天气应用等,让你将所学知识应用于实际项目中。
总结
通过康康金棕教程的学习,你将能够轻松掌握Swift编程的基本技巧,为成为优秀的移动开发者打下坚实的基础。记住,编程是一门实践性很强的技能,多动手实践是提高编程水平的关键。祝你在Swift编程的道路上越走越远!
